Darting or flashing in Green Terror Cichlids often indicates stress or irritation from external factors. This behavior is usually not serious but can lead to more severe issues if not addressed promptly. Owners should first ensure the tank conditions are optimal for their aggressive nature.
Common Causes of Darting or Flashing in Green Terror Cichlid
Poor Water Quality
Most LikelyHigh ammonia or nitrite levels can stress the fish.
Inadequate Tank Size
Most LikelyInsufficient space can lead to aggression and stress.
Dietary Issues
PossibleImproper diet or lack of variety can cause stress.
Water Temperature Fluctuations
PossibleSudden changes in water temperature can be very stressful.
External Irritants
Less CommonPhysical objects or plants in the tank may cause rubbing or darting.
How to Diagnose
Follow these steps in order. Stop when you identify a likely cause and move to treatment.
- Observe the fish's tank conditions closely.
Check for any visible stressors like broken plants or aggressive tankmates.
- Test the water parameters for ammonia, nitrite, and nitrate.
Use a reliable test kit to ensure the water quality is within the optimal range.
Recommended: Water test kit - Evaluate the tank size and its suitability for the Green Terror Cichlid's size and temperament.
Ensure the tank is spacious enough for the fish to swim and not feel overcrowded.
- Assess the diet and ensure it's balanced and varied.
Feed a diet rich in proteins and vitamins to maintain overall health.
- Inspect the tank for any physical irritants like sharp edges or rough surfaces.
Remove any objects that may cause rubbing or darting.
How to Fix It
- Improve water quality by changing 25% of the tank water weekly.
Ensure the water is from a reliable source and dechlorinated.
- Increase the tank size if necessary, or remove aggressive tankmates if possible.
Provide more space for the fish to swim and reduce stress.
- Adjust the diet to include more variety and ensure proper nutrition.
Consider including live foods or high-quality pellets.
- Stabilize water temperature to the optimal range of 22.0โ28.0ยฐC.
Use a reliable heater to maintain consistent temperature.
- Remove any physical irritants from the tank to prevent further rubbing or darting.
Replace rough surfaces with smooth, non-irritating materials.
